Remusatia vivipara
What's the taxonomical classification of Remusatia vivipara?
Remusatia vivipara belongs to the kingdom Plantae and is classified within the phylum Streptophyta. As a member of the class Equisetopsida and the subclass Magnoliidae, it is positioned under the order Alismatales. This plant is further categorized into the family Araceae, falling under the specific genus Remusatia, with its unique identity defined by the species name vivipara.
| Taxonomic Rank | Classification |
|---|---|
| Kingdom | Plantae |
| Phylum | Streptophyta |
| Class | Equisetopsida |
| Subclass | Magnoliidae |
| Order | Alismatales |
| Family | Araceae |
| Genus | Remusatia |
| Species | vivipara |
